   Turkey Club Sandwich

Serves: 1 serving
Ingredients
  • 3 slices toasted white bread
  • 4 1/2 teaspoons mayonnaise
  • 3 ounces sliced turkey breast
  • 2 iceberg lettucce leaves
  • 2 to 3 slices cooked bacon
  • 2 tomato slices
Instructions
  1. Spread about 1 1/2 teaspoons mayonnaise on one side of each toasted white bread slice.  
  2.  Arrange the turkey breast on one slice of toast.  
  3.  Tear or fold one iceberg lettuce leaf to fit on the sliced turkey.  
  4.  Stack on another slice of toast with the mayo side facing up.  
  5.  Break 2 or 3 slices of cooked bacon to fit on top of the second slice of toast.  
  6.  Tear or fold the second lettuce leaf to fit on top of bacon. 
  7.  Arrange the two tomato slices to fit on the lettuce.  
  8.  Top off the sandwich with the last piece of toast turned with the mayo-coated side facing down. 
  9.  Pierce the sandwich with four toothpicks between the corners, so that when the sandwich is sliced from corner to corner, then the oher way from corner to corner, with a serrated knife, the toothpicks wind up in the center of each of the four slices.
